Canada - Re-Export of Citrus Juice
Since 2014, Canada Re-Export of Citrus Juice jumped by 33.6%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 3 comparing other countries in Re-Export of Citrus Juice with $2,183,774.5. Canada is overtaken by United States, which was ranked number 2 with $4,756,446 and is followed by Oman at $471,716.47. United Arab Emirates ranked the highest with $8,120,580.38 in 2019, that is a fall of 21.2% versus 2018. Trinidad and Tobago witnessed the best average annual growth at +89% per year, while Namibia recorded the worst performance at -3.8% per year.
